What Is An Overbite?

When the upper jaw and teeth cross the bottom jaw and teeth, this is known as an open bite or overbite. They are a kind of bone deformity, according to dentists and oral surgeons. An overbite can be either horizontal or vertical. A horizontal overbite is when the top teeth protrude over the bottom teeth, whereas a vertical overbite is when the top teeth overhang the bottom teeth, sometimes these are called overjets. Some individuals may exhibit both of these symptoms. Buck teeth or an overbite may also be structural or dental in nature. Dental overbites occur when the molars are positioned incorrectly, and bone overbites are brought on by the jaw. This is the most frequent dental condition in kids and also adults(sometimes).

Causes Of An Overbite

Both toddlers and adults develop overbites caused by genetics, specific personal behaviors, and other variables. To assist you in better-comprehending overbites and their causes, let’s take a closer look.

Most overbites are just a result of genetics. Youngsters are often more prone to acquire an overbite if one of their parents does. Although there isn’t much you can do to stop it, you can start the orthodontic strategic changes by scheduling your child’s appointment at age seven. Furthermore, many kids have shorter bottom molars from birth or experience various problems with their jaws. If not identified and corrected again when the child is old enough to undergo treatment, these problems can potentially result in an overbite.

Conversely, several behaviors can raise the likelihood of buck teeth. Children who use pacifiers for an extended amount of time or young children who thumb-suck for a prolonged period of time can acquire an overbite. Adults who have an overbite, chew on pens and perhaps other hard objects, smash their teeth, or have bruxism, can also acquire an overbite. It’s conceivable that some individuals have a biological propensity to have buck teeth. Nevertheless, genetics apart, avoiding the aforementioned practices can help reduce the likelihood of acquiring an overbite. Do Braces Fix Overbite?

Braces are frequently suggested by orthodontists to correct a dislocated jaw since they successfully address the majority of overbite disorders. How do braces correct an overbite, then? The evaluation phase marks the beginning of the therapeutic procedure. Dentist will first obtain X-rays to assess the state of your teeth in order to identify the type of overbite and the connection between both the jaw and teeth. Braces are then attached after that. In order to realign the teeth, metallic hooks are attached to the top and bottom teeth, and these brackets and wires are then connected. After the straightening is finished, the buck tooth is corrected. Among the dental problems that take the hardest to correct with braces is a deep overbite. The buck teeth are frequently not the primary issue, either. There are several issues to address because the patient often has congestion or misaligned teeth. Although every situation is unique, extremely misaligned teeth cases may necessitate braces for two years minimum. A retainer is used to preserve the teeth firmly in place after the braces are removed.
